AU59 CWZ is a 2009 Ajs Nac 12 in Black with a 124c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55.6%.
Across all 2009 Ajs Nac 12 models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.2% with a typical mileage of 6,783 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ajs Nac 12 fails its MOT is footrest missing, accounting for 19 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AU59 CWZ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ajs Nac 12 typically stays on UK roads for around 17 years. At 17 years old, this Ajs Nac 12 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
